Modern Men offers a fresh male perspective on modern relationships. Tim Clarke, Kyle Brewster, and Doug Reynolds are childhood friends who, now in their late twenties, have arrived at different places in their lives when it comes to women. Desperate for advice and guidance in matters of the heart, they seek the help of Dr. Victoria Stangel, a renowned and beautiful life coach. The problems these three friends have with women are all over the emotional map. Doug can't move on from Allie, his high school sweetheart and ex-wife. Learning how to date again is especially tough for Doug since the last time he was single and looking was when he was 15. Kyle has the opposite problem. An inveterate Lothario, Kyle cavalierly jumps from woman to woman in order to hide the fact that, secretly, he's terrified that no one out there pictures him as the one.

Saturday Night Live is an Emmy Award-winning late-night comedy showcase.

Since its inception in 1975, "SNL" has launched the careers of many of the brightest comedy performers of their generation. As The New York Times noted on the occasion of the show's Emmy-winning 25th Anniversary special in 1999, "in defiance of both time and show business convention, 'SNL' is still the most pervasive influence on the art of comedy in contemporary culture." At the close of the century, "Saturday Night Live" placed seventh on Entertainment Weekly's list of the Top 100 Entertainers of the past fifty years.
